Version 0.3.0.33 (Beta)

After a long hiatus, it is more than about time to add some improvements to InsPMDic application. In this version, minor changes were made to the GUI. On the other hand, new functionalities were added to make it more powerful yet keeping it simple to use, despite it demanded a lot of extra coding.

The major achievement is that it now can directly extract dictionaries from packaging files with the ZIP (generic), OXT (LibreOffice/OpenOffice), and XPI (Mozilla's Firefox/Thunderbird) extensions, the three major packaging form where Hunspell files are found in the Web.

As an accessory application to Pegasus Mail, it now has the ability to "install" itself into its application toolbar by creating a Form Fact File (FFF), deploying an application bitmap, and by using Gerard Thomas' 32-bit runexe.dll. If this DLL is missing from Pmail working directory it will also be deployed there.

Considering that those changes would add some complexity to InsPMDic's operation, a brand new HTML Help file (CHM) was created to guide the user on application's usage and methods. This help file may be called from the application using the F1 key. A help sensitive to the context will be available in further versions.

Finally, all documentation and Web page text was checked after misspelled words and grammar checking. I hope it is now minimally acceptable. Please advise me if otherwise.

Version 0.2.3.20 (Beta)

  • Hidden files and directories are now viewable from application's "Select either a .dic or .aff file" browse dialog. This is done by a momentaneous Windows' Registry override to overcome certain environments (e.g. Wine) settings. Hidden files are shown dimmed to differ from normal files.
  • Pegasus Mail can't see hidden files. This means that Pegasus Mail won't display on its available dictionary list those whose files (.aff and .dic) have a Hidden attribute, and/or because the top level directory where they are also have a Hidden attribute. It doesn't matter if they are remote files correctly referenced within its .v5dict control file or local dictionaries copied to Pmail's \DICTS directory. If files have a Hidden attribute Pegasus Mail won't treat them as valid and will ignore them gracefully. To overcome this minor nuisance, hidden files MUST me copied to \DICTS using InsPMDic. InsPMDic will remove its Hidden attribute at destination so to work properly in Pmail.
